## Parking Wars: North Shore Saw Surge of Fans for Backyard Brawl, Pirates Game ### Traffic Packed North Shore Amidst Football and Baseball Rivalry The North Shore faced a parking crunch over the weekend, as tens of thousands of fans descended upon the area for the Backyard Brawl football game at Acrisure Stadium and the Pittsburgh Pirates home game at PNC Park. The Backyard Brawl, which saw the University of Pittsburgh Panthers defeat the West Virginia University Mountaineers 38-31, drew more than 60,000 fans. Meanwhile, the Pirates game against the Chicago Cubs attracted over 35,000 fans. The influx of visitors led to heavy traffic and parking problems throughout the North Shore. Many fans were forced to park blocks away from the stadiums or pay exorbitant prices for parking spots. Some fans said they were frustrated by the parking situation, but others said they were willing to put up with the hassle to attend the big games. "It was a little bit of a pain to find parking, but it was worth it to see Pitt win," said one fan. "We had to walk a few blocks to get to the stadium, but it was a great atmosphere," said another fan. The Pittsburgh Police Department reported that there were no major incidents during the weekend. ### Tips for Parking on the North Shore If you're planning on attending an event on the North Shore, here are a few tips for finding parking: * Arrive early.
